On Wed, 16 Jun 1999, John M. Flinchbaugh wrote:

> On Wed, 16 Jun 1999, Robert Chalmers wrote:
> > Just installed 6.5, all seems well, but it wont start - claims initdb didn't
> > creat the database 'postgres' ...
> > whats happening here ?
>
> initdb only creates `template1'.  you have to `createdb postgres' for
> yourself if you even want the postgres user to have it's own personal
> database.

So, just to elaborate on the problem report to start with, the problem is
starting up the back and just typing 'psql', vs 'psql template1'?
